Abstract :
Monitoring represents an important factor in improving the quality of the services provided in cloud computing, given the fact that it allows scaling resource utilization in an adaptive manner. It is widely used for detecting critical events and abnormalities of distributed systems and also it helps identifying the faults within the system, discovering application patterns for the users. As cloud systems increase their architecture, the degree of workload also grows in datacenters, causing node failures and performance issues. This paper aims to provide a solution for the monitoring of cloud computing systems and services, allowing users and also providers to optimize the usage of the computational resources according to the constantly changing business requirements inside an organization. The main contribution of the paper consists of the integration of the monitoring system, which is based on Nagios and NConf with a test cloud architecture. Finally, the paper discusses the main findings for a reference implementation using the OpenStack cloud platform.
